* { margin:0; padding:0;}
body { background:url(../images/top_bg.gif) repeat-x top #e0e0e0; font-size:100%; line-height:1em; font-family:Arial; color:#636363;}
#main {margin: 0 auto; text-align: center;}

/*in_line*/
input, select, textarea { vertical-align:middle; font-weight:normal; font-family:Arial; color:#000000; font-weight:normal;}
img {border:0; vertical-align:top; text-align:left;}
ul { list-style:none;}

/*==================list====================*/
ul{margin:0 0 15px 0; padding:0px; list-style:none}
ul li { line-height:1.25em}
ul li a{text-decoration:none; color:#cb1005; font-weight:bold}
ul li a:hover{ text-decoration:none; color:#40403d}
/*==========================================*/

dt {font-size:1em; color:#cb1005; font-weight:bold; margin:0}
dd {margin-bottom:14px}

a {text-decoration:underline; color:#636363}
a:hover {text-decoration:none}

a.link {text-decoration:none; color:#d52d00; background:url(../images/marker_link.gif) no-repeat 0 2px; padding-left:21px; font-family:century gothic; font-size:0.93em; line-height:2em; float:right; margin:0 0 0 20px; font-weight:bold}
a.link:hover {text-decoration:none; color:#000}

a.link_2 {text-decoration:none; color:#d52d00; background:url(../images/marker_link_2.gif) no-repeat 0 2px; padding-left:21px; font-family:century gothic; font-size:0.93em; line-height:2em; float:right; margin:0 0 0 20px; font-weight:bold}
a.link_2:hover {text-decoration:none; color:#000}

a.link_3 {text-decoration:underline; color:#d52d00; font-size:0.93em; font-weight:bold; font-family:century gothic}
a.link_3:hover {text-decoration:none}


.fleft {float:left}
.fright {float:right}
.clear { clear:both;}

.font_1 {font-size:0.92em; color:#40403d; line-height:1.36em}
.font_2 {font-size:1em; color:#cb1005; font-weight:bold}
.font_3 {font-size:0.92em; color:#444444; font-weight:bold; line-height:1.09em}
.font_4 {font-size:0.93em; color:#cb1005; font-weight:bold; font-family:century gothic}

h4 {font-size:0.92em; color:#444444; line-height:1.09em; margin:0 0 6px 0}

.bg_1 {background:url(../images/bg_1.jpg) no-repeat right top}
.bg_2 {background:url(../images/bg_2.jpg) no-repeat 293px 0}
.bg_3 {background:url(../images/bg_3.jpg) no-repeat 328px 0}
.bg_4 {background:url(../images/bg_4.jpg) no-repeat 317px 0}
.bg_5 {background:url(../images/bg_5.jpg) no-repeat 320px 0}
.bg_6 {background:url(../images/bg_6.jpg) no-repeat 317px 0}
.bg_7 {background:url(../images/bg_7.jpg) no-repeat right top}
.bg_8 {background:url(../images/bg_8.jpg) no-repeat 308px 0}


.but {background:url(../images/but_bg.jpg) repeat-x top; color:#fff; font-size:11px; float:left; margin:10px 0 0 10px}
.but .left {background:url(../images/but_left.jpg) no-repeat 0 0; float:left}
.but .right {background:url(../images/but_right.jpg) no-repeat right top; float:left; padding:4px 15px 10px 10px}
.but a {color:#fff; font-weight:bold; text-decoration:none}
.but a:hover {color:#000}

.but_1 {background:url(../images/but_bg.jpg) repeat-x top; color:#fff; float:right; font-size:11px; margin:10px 0 0 10px; width:52px}
.but_1 .left {background:url(../images/but_left.jpg) no-repeat 0 0; float:right}
.but_1 .right {background:url(../images/but_right.jpg) no-repeat right top; float:right; padding:4px 15px 10px 10px}
.but_1 a {color:#fff; font-weight:bold; text-decoration:none}
.but_1 a:hover {color:#000}


/*header*/
#header { background:url(../images/header_bg.jpg) no-repeat 0 0; height:260px; margin:o auto; text-align:center;}
#header img {margin:o auto; text-align:center;}
#container{background:url(../images/container.jpg) no-repeat left top; }
#container_bot { background:url(../images/bot_bg.jpg) no-repeat left top; }

/*content*/
#content {font-size:0.93em; line-height:1.25em}

.menu {position:absolute;margin:36px 0 0 717px; [if lte IE 7.0]margin:36px 0 0 349px;}
.menu img {display:block}


.title {margin-bottom:20px}
.img_left {float:left; margin:0 20px 0 0}
.img {margin-bottom:15px}

.jump_1 {width:136px; height:18px; border:solid 1px #9f9f9e; font-size:1em; color:#a3a3a1; padding-left:5px; margin-left:5px}
.jump_2 {width:86px; height:18px; border:solid 1px #9f9f9e; font-size:1em; color:#a3a3a1; padding-left:5px; margin-left:5px}

.input_1 {width:131px; height:16px; border:solid 1px #9f9f9e; font-size:1em; color:#a3a3a1; padding-left:5px; margin-left:5px}
.input_2 {width:81px; height:16px; border:solid 1px #9f9f9e; font-size:1em; color:#a3a3a1; padding-left:5px; margin-left:5px}
.input_3 {width:131px; height:16px; border:solid 1px #9f9f9e; color:#000000; font-size:1em; padding-left:5px; margin-left:5px}

.div_input {height:24px}



textarea {width:331px; height:108px; border:solid 1px #9f9f9e; color:#000000; font-size:1em; padding-left:5px; margin-left:5px}

p {margin:0 0 15px 0}



/*footer*/
#footer {background:url(../images/bot_bg.jpg) no-repeat left bottom;  font-family:Arial; font-size:0.6875em; line-height:1.09em; color:#444444; font-weight:bold}
#footer a {color:#444444; text-decoration:none}
#footer a:hover { color:#cb1005}

#footer a.rss {color:#444444; text-decoration:none; font-weight:normal; background:url(../images/rss_img.jpg) no-repeat 0 0; padding:2px 0 0 23px}
#footer a.rss:hover { text-decoration:underline}


/*================== index.html ==================*/
#page1 #content .col_1 .indent { padding:0px 20px 10px 0px}
#page1 #content .col_1 .box {width:198px; height:24px}
#page1 #content .col_1 .col_box_1 {width:45px; text-align:right}
#page1 #content .col_1 .col_box_2 {width:153px}
#page1 #content .col_2 .indent { padding:20px 0px 45px 66px}
#page1 #content .col_2 .inden_1 { padding:0 55px 43px 26px}
#page1 #content .col_2 .price {width:218px; height:28px; margin-left:135px}

/*================== index-1.html ==================*/
#page2 #content .col_1 .indent { padding:0px 20px 10px 0px}
#page2 #content .col_1 .box {width:198px; height:24px}
#page2 #content .col_1 .col_box_1 {width:45px; text-align:right}
#page2 #content .col_1 .col_box_2 {width:153px}
#page2 #content .col_2 .indent { padding:20px 0px 45px 66px}
#page2 #content .col_2 .inden_1 { padding:0 55px 43px 26px}
#page2 #content .col_2 .price {width:218px; height:28px; margin-left:135px}
#page2 #content .menu {
    position:absolute;
    margin:36px 0 0 349px
}
#page2 #content .menu img {display:block}
/*================== index-2.html ==================*/
#page3 #content .col_1 .indent { padding:47px 30px 30px 51px}
#page3 #content .col_2 .indent { padding:49px 55px 40px 46px}
#page3 #content .col_2 .inden_1 { padding:0 55px 43px 46px}


/*================== index-3.html ==================*/
#page4 #content .col_1 .indent { padding:48px 20px 40px 51px}
#page4 #content .col_1 .box {width:198px; height:24px}
#page4 #content .col_1 .col_box_1 {width:45px; text-align:right}
#page4 #content .col_1 .col_box_2 {width:153px}
#page4 #content .col_2 .indent { padding:49px 55px 46px 46px}
#page4 #content .col_2 .inden_1 { padding:0 55px 27px 46px}
#page4 #content .col_2 .box {width:355px}
#page4 #content .col_2 .col_box_1 {width:158px; margin-right:36px}
#page4 #content .col_2 .col_box_2 {width:161px}


/*================== index-4.html ==================*/
#page5 #content .col_1 .indent { padding:47px 20px 40px 51px}
#page5 #content .col_1 .div_links {height:30px; width:182px}
#page5 #content .col_1 .box {width:190px}
#page5 #content .col_1 .col_box_1 {width:48px; text-align:right}
#page5 #content .col_1 .col_box_2 {width:142px}
#page5 #content .col_2 .indent { padding:47px 55px 46px 46px}
#page5 #content .col_2 .inden_1 { padding:0 55px 60px 46px}
#page5 #content .col_2 .box {width:355px}
#page5 #content .col_2 .col_box_1 {width:158px; margin-right:36px}
#page5 #content .col_2 .col_box_2 {width:161px}


/*================== index-5.html ==================*/
#page6 #content .col_1 .indent { padding:47px 33px 31px 51px}
#page6 #content .col_2 .indent { padding:49px 59px 40px 46px}


/*==================block====================*/
.block { background:url(../images/block_bg.jpg) repeat-y left;  }
.block .top {background:url(../images/block_top.jpg) no-repeat left top; }
.block .bot { background:url(../images/bot_bg.jpg) no-repeat left bottom;}
/*==========================================*/

.Stile10 {
font-family:Arial;
font-size:10px;
}

.Stile11 {
font-family:Arial;
font-size:11px;
}

.Stile12 {
font-family:Arial;
font-size:12px;
}

.Stile12R {
font-family:Arial;
font-size:12px;
color: #FF0000;
}

.Stile12b {
font-family:Arial;
font-size:12;
font:bold;
color:#080262;
}

.Stile12i {
font-family:Arial;
font-size:12px;
font-style:italic;
font:bold;
}

.Stile14 {
font-family:Arial;
font-size:14px;
}

.Stile16 {
font-family:Arial;
font-size:16px;
}

.Stile16ib {
font-family:Arial;
font-size:16px;
font-style:italic;
font:bold;
color:#080262;
}

.Stile30 {
font-family:Arial;
font-size:30px;
color:#ffffff;
}